Andreas Baecker Obituary

Andreas Alfred Baecker St. Charles, IL Formerly of Williamston Born in Lansing, MIchigan on May 16, 1962 and passed away on March 25, 2012 at Hospice & Palliative Care of Barrington, IL at the age of 49. Our dear son is finally at peace following a valiant fight against a brain tumor. Andy resided in St. Charles, IL. He is survived by his wife, Francoise, son Alexander (Alex), parents Walter and Anka Baecker, sister Kathy, (John Smith), niece Nicole Smith, and numerous aunts, uncles, nephews and cousins. Andy was known for his enormous determination of getting things done. He was a Senior Director of Sales for COUPONS-INC. He worked out of his home office and traveled frequently to administer business. They could count on him to win the deal, he was not a quitter. Andy was very handy around the house always repairing, building and replacing something. He completely remodeled his home in Norwalk, Connecticut. Shortly after moving to St. Charles he designed and built his office, recreation room and rebuilt a deck with his neighborhood buddies, he loved sailing, surf boarding, fishing, deer hunting with his uncles and cousin Steve and was a fanatic Tigers baseball fan. A celebration of life service will be held at The English Inn (Medovue Hall) Eaton Rapids, MI. on April 15, 2012, 12:00 until 4:00p.m. Memorial contributions may be given to a place of your choice.
